WebDemodex blepharitis accounts for approximately 45–50% of blepharitis. Patient complaints vary, Dr. de Luise said, with symptoms of irritation, discomfort, itching, burning, and foreign body sensation often elicited. Signs of Demodex infestation include collarettes and crusting or matting of eyelashes, tearing, and blurry vision.
